  • NCFE qualifications available for SFA funding

    Thursday 23 October 2014

    The latest version of the Skills Funding Agency (SFA) catalogue has been released and we’re pleased to say we have a further 16 now on the list, making a total of 241 NCFE qualifications now eligible for funding.

  • Extension of NCFE Level 2 Diplomas In Health and Social Care (Adults) for England

    Tuesday 21 October 2014

    The following qualifications* have been extended until December 2016.

    • NCFE Level 2 Diploma In Health and Social Care (Adults) for England (501/2318/X)
    • NCFE Level 2 Diploma In Health and Social Care (Adults) for England (Adults with Learning Disabilities (501/2318/X/ALD)
    • NCFE Level 2 Diploma In Health and Social Care (Adults) for England (Dementia) (501/2318/X/DEM)
